Portland firefighter memorial near Providence Park damaged by vandals

Some name plates of firefighters who died on duty were stolen from the David Campbell Memorial. Lanterns were shattered and Italian limestone was chipped.

PORTLAND, Oregon — A memorial honoring Portland firefighters in the line of duty was recently damaged and vandalized. The memorial has stood near Burnside in southwest Portland for almost 100 years.

The David Campbell Memorial has long been forgotten by many Portland residents, and instead been trashed and spray painted. This week, someone removed brass name plates of firefighters who gave their lives.

“It’s just senseless vandalism,” Don Porth, a retired Portland firefighter said.
